Ansible : Comment mettre fin à toutes les instances AWS EC2 à l'aide du script Ansible ?

Publié: 2020-07-12
Mettre fin aux instances AWS EC2 à l'aide d'Ansible

Comme vous le savez probablement maintenant, j'ai beaucoup travaillé sur Ansible ces derniers temps. Dans ce didacticiel, nous verrons comment mettre fin à toutes les instances AWS EC2 par programmation à l'aide du script Ansible.

Avant de parcourir ce didacticiel, assurez-vous d'avoir correctement configuré Ansible sur votre ordinateur portable/de bureau.

Sur Crunchify, nous avons plus de 30 tutoriels Ansible et ceux-ci reçoivent tellement d'amour de la part des lecteurs/utilisateurs.

Commençons:

Étape 1:

Assurez-vous d'avoir correctement configuré ansible sur votre site.

Étape 2

Créez quelques instances EC2.

Comment créer, démarrer et configurer une instance Amazon EC2 à l'aide d'un simple script Ansible ? (lancer la machine virtuelle à distance)

Étape 3

Terminez les instances EC2 nouvellement créées.

Créez le fichier crunchify_ec2_terminate.yml .

  • Le module ec2_instance_facts rassemble des faits sur les instances ec2 dans AWS.
  • Le module ec2 est utilisé pour créer, résilier, démarrer ou arrêter une instance dans ec2.

État:

  • absent
  • redémarré
  • fonctionnement
  • arrêté
État du module EC2 Ansible

Exécutez la commande :

commande : ansible-playbook -vvv crunchify_ec2_terminate.yml

Sortie console :

Ouvrez la page de l'instance Amazon EC2 :

Lien : https://us-east-2.console.aws.amazon.com/ec2/v2/home?region=us-east-2#Instances:sort=instanceId

Résilier les instances AWS EC2 à l'aide d'Ansible - Crunchify Tips

J'espère que cela vous aidera à mettre fin aux instances Amazon EC2 via Ansible.